2006 Free Agent Offensive Tackles

Here is a list of the free agent tackles for next year. It may be missing a few, but who would you like to see the Chiefs make a run at??

OL Stocker McDougle
OL Alonzo Ephraim (RFA)
OT Scott Gragg
OT Barrett Brooks
OT L.J. Shelton
OT Tony Pashos (RFA)
OT Makoa Freitas (RFA)
OT Mike Pearson
OT Ephraim Salaam
OT Seth Wand (RFA)
OT Victor Riley
OT Chad Slaughter
OT Jordan Black (RFA)
OT Courtney Van Buren (RFA)
OT Ethan Brooks
OT Torrin Tucker (RFA)
OT John St. Clair
OT Jeff Backus
OT Kevin Barry
OT Todd Fordham
OT Todd Steussie
OT Kevin Shaffer
OT Barry Stokes
OT Rex Tucker
OT Wayne Hunter (RFA)
OT Anthony Clement

He went to Northwest Missouri State and was drafted in the 3rd round by the Texans. He is huge and moves well, I believe he started last year, but isn't starting this year. He would be more of a project, but the upside is worth a flier, plus he wouldn't cost much.
